Increasing the shipstate Field Size in the Customer Table
Some international post offices require a larger letter state/province abbreviation.
For example: The Australia Post requires that the state of Victoria be abbreviated as Vic
- Double-click to open the shop.mdb file located in the fpdb folder from Windows Explorer. This will open the database in Access.
- Maximize the Shop Database screen.
- From the Objects frame, select Tables.
- Highlight by clicking once on the Customer table and click on Design from the Access task bar.
- Click once in the shipstate field and then change the Field Size located in the General tab to a larger number.
- Save your changes.
You can now enter an abbreviation equal to the number of letters you have increased it by.
